What is Volkswagen Financial Services?

Volkswagen Financial Services is the financial arm of the Volkswagen Group, providing a range of financial products and services to individual and business customers. These services include vehicle financing, leasing, insurance, and fleet management for Volkswagen and other brands within the Group. The goal is to make it easier for customers to purchase or lease vehicles by offering flexible payment options and comprehensive financial solutions. Volkswagen Financial Services operates globally, supporting customers and dealers in over 50 countries.

What are the typical daily responsibilities for someone working at Volkswagen Financial Services?

At Volkswagen Financial Services, daily responsibilities often include evaluating loan or lease applications, assisting customers with financing options, and coordinating with dealerships to process transactions efficiently. Employees also manage client accounts, address inquiries related to payment plans or products, and ensure compliance with industry regulations. Collaboration with sales teams and internal departments is common, fostering a dynamic work environment focused on delivering excellent customer service and financial solutions.

Role Summary
The Financial Planning & Reporting Specialist will build and maintain financial models that report actuals & forecast the P&L, Balance Sheet and Cash Flow statement for the VWFSPS insurance company. They will be solely responsible for building month, yearly and 5 year financial performance projections.
The Specialist will also be responsible for reporting all figures up to internal management and our global headquarters through proprietary reporting software.
They will work cross-functionally across the organization in order to define and monitor KPIs to measure performance against volume and financial objectives, recognizing risks and opportunities in a timely manner and suggesting alternative actions to accomplish the objectives.
Responsibilities within this Role
โ€ข Work closely with the Sr. Director of Controlling, VWFSPS Insurance Team, Treasurer, SVP Finance, CFO and accounting/controlling functions in order to forecast VWFS Protection Services P&L, Balance Sheet and Cash Flow Statement.
โ€ข Build and maintain a multi-year financial planning tool for all VWFS entities (P&L, balance sheet, cash flow), under IFRS standards. This includes different aspects of the business model (dealer reinsurance, direct underwriting, reinsurance / fronting arrangements)
โ€ข Responsible for financial modeling and data analysis to identify monthly trends (and develop mitigation plans as necessary), ensure objectives accomplishment, and share strategic business insights.
โ€ข Prepare the monthly, annual, and 5 year plan for VWFS Protection Services business and the VCI ancillary business.
โ€ข Complete and analyze specialized reporting documents required from HQ & VWFSPS Management
โ€ข Run periodic product profitability and production analysis
โ€ข Develop senior management presentations.
โ€ข Complete ad hoc analyses and reporting as required.

Volkswagen Financial Services - The key to mobility
VW Credit, Inc., dba Volkswagen Financial Services (VWFS), was founded in 1981 as the captive financial services arm of Volkswagen Group of America, Inc. and is affiliated with Volkswagen of America, Inc., Audi of America, Inc. and Ducati North America, Inc. VWFS offers services to Volkswagen, Audi, Ducati customers, and authorized dealers as Volkswagen Financial Services, Volkswagen Credit, Audi Financial Services, and Ducati Financial Services. The company offers competitive financial products and services to customers and authorized dealers in the United States. VWFS is headquartered in Reston, VA.
